Abstract: | Abstract Although there exists a large variety of copula functions, only a few are practically manageable, and often the choice in dependence modeling falls on the Gaussian copula. Furthermore most copulas are exchangeable, thus implying symmetric dependence. We introduce a way to construct copulas based on periodic functions. We study the two-dimensional case based on one dependence parameter and then provide a way to extend the construction to the n-dimensional framework. We can thus construct families of copulas in dimension n and parameterized by n ? 1 parameters, implying possibly asymmetric relations. Such “periodic” copulas can be simulated easily. |
